New Haven, MI 48051 Frost Dates

New Haven, MI: when does the frost end?

Zone 6b

The last spring frost here typically falls around 04/30, about 245 days from today. Fall's first freeze usually shows up around 10/24, roughly 174 days after the last spring frost.

New Haven sits in USDA Zone 6b (-5 to 0°F average annual minimum). The dates above are NOAA's 1991-2020 normal at the nearest reporting station, a 30-year average, not a forecast.

The actual range around New Haven's last frost

04/30 is the middle of 30 years of NOAA records, not a promise. Getting tender plants in by 04/16 carries real risk, frost has hit that late in about 9 of 10 years here. Wait until 05/15 and only about 1 year in 10 sees frost after that.
